Vitamin D (as cholecalciferol)Very Good
Vitamin D is essential for calcium absorption and bone health. Cholecalciferol is a high-quality form of Vitamin D that is well-absorbed by the body. It supports immune function and may improve mood.
Benefits
Supports bone health and enhances calcium absorption.
Calcium (as tricalcium phosphate)Very Good
Calcium is crucial for maintaining strong bones and teeth. Tricalcium phosphate is a commonly used form that provides both calcium and phosphorus, which are important for bone mineralization. It is well-tolerated and effective in dietary supplements.

Phosphorus (as tricalcium phosphate)Good
Phosphorus is a vital mineral that works with calcium to build strong bones and teeth. It is present in tricalcium phosphate, which is a stable and effective form for supplementation. Phosphorus also plays a role in energy production and cellular function.

Medium Chain TriglyceridesGood
Medium chain triglycerides (MCTs) are fats that are easily absorbed and used for energy. They are often included in supplements for their potential to support weight management and cognitive function. MCTs are derived from coconut or palm kernel oil.
